Ignis

Ai

A mysterious AI program, sought after by the Knights of Hanoi and SOL Technologies Inc., that Yusaku, Ai's Origin, captures. Belongs to an AI species with free will, known as the Ignis, and is based on the DARK Attribute.

Flame

An Ignis who was created from and is partnered with Takeru Homura, and is based on the FIRE Attribute. The pair visit Yusaku and Ai after being informed that the Cyberse World was destroyed.

Aqua

An Ignis who was created from Miyu, a childhood friend of Aoi's. Based on the WATER Attribute, she is partnered with Blue Maiden (i.e. Aoi's third Online Alias).


Windy

An Ignis based on the WIND Attribute, he initially comes off as neutral in the conflict instigated in the second season. Earth

One of the six Ignis created by Kogami. Is based on the EARTH attribute. Earth uses a "G Golem" deck, an archetype of EARTH Cyberse-Type Monsters. His human partner is assumed to be Spectre.

Origins

Yusaku Fujiki

Yusaku is the Origin of Ai, the DARK Ignis. As a result of the incident, he became very traumatized and was unable to live a normal life no matter how much help he got. In order to let to go of his past, he decides to put matters into his own hands and became Playmaker, the envoy of revenge, and fights against the Knights of Hanoi in order to recover the truth of his past for the sake of himself and the people affected by the incident.

Takeru Homura

Takeru is the Origin of Flame, the FIRE Ignis. As a result of the incident along with the death of his parents during their search for him, he became a Hikikomori and never went to school for years. However after learning about the three heroes of VRAINS and their battle against the people who made him suffer along with meeting his Ignis, Flame. He decides to move forward and fight alongside Playmaker against the faction that destroyed the Cyberse World.

Spectre

Spectre is the Origin of Earth, the EARTH Ignis. However unlike the other Origins, he wasn't traumatized by the Lost Incident/Hanoi Project, but rather enjoyed it since it was the first time he felt he got a purpose in life. This caused him to join the Knights of Hanoi as one of their high ranking members to ensure that his time will keep moving.
